Around midnight, under a lonely street lamp in a provincial town in Japan, lies a white woman, a blonde, alone, robbed of all four limbs, yet undead. Indeed, a rumor's been circulating among the local girls that a vampire has come to their backwater, of all places. Koyomi Araragi, who prefers to avoid having friends because they'd lower his "intensity as a human, " is naturally skeptical. Yet it is to him that the bloodsucking demon, a concept "dated twice over, " beckons on the first day of spring break as he makes his way home with a fresh loot of morally compromising periodicals. Always disarmingly candid, often hilariously playful, and sometimes devastatingly moving, K I Z U M O N O G A T A R I: Wound Tale is the perfect gateway into the world of author N I S I O I S I N, the bestselling young novelist in Japan today. The prequel to B A K E M O N O G A T A R I (" Monster Tale"), this is where the legendary M O N O G A T A R I series, whose anime adaptations have enjoyed international popularity and critical acclaim, begins. A theatrical feature based on K I Z U M O N O G A T A R I is due to be released in Japan in January 2016.
